Garlic Butter Shrimp Zucchini Boats: A 30-Minute Flavor Bomb


  • Author: lucy
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Low Calorie

Description

Garlic butter shrimp zucchini boats are a healthy and flavorful dinner option. These stuffed zucchini boats are filled with rice and topped with seasoned shrimp, baked to perfection.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 3 medium zucchini, halved lengthwise
  • 2 cups cooked white rice (or jasmine rice)
  • 1 lb large shrimp, peeled & deveined (tails on optional)
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 3 tbsp butter, melted
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• 1/2 tsp Italian seasoning (or dried parsley)
  • 1/2 tsp salt (plus more to taste)
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• 2 tbsp sliced green onions (optional, for topping)
  • 1 tbsp chopped parsley (optional, for topping)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F.
  2. Slice zucchini in half lengthwise. Scoop out a little center to make a “boat” (optional). Place on a baking sheet.
  3. Spoon cooked rice into each zucchini boat.
  4. In a bowl, toss shrimp with olive oil, paprika,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  5. Arrange shrimp on top of the rice-filled zucchini boats.
  6. Mix melted butter, garlic, and lemon juice. Drizzle over the shrimp and zucchini.
  7. Bake 12–15 minutes until shrimp are pink and cooked through and zucchini is tender.
  8. Top with green onions/parsley and serve warm.

Notes

  • You can use quinoa instead of rice for a healthier option.
  • Adjust seasoning to taste.
  • For extra flavor, add grated Parmesan cheese before baking.
